Muslin is India’s most ancient fine fabric — woven from ultra-fine hand-spun cotton, it was once so delicate it was called ‘woven air’. Ikat is a resist-dyeing technique where threads are dyed before weaving, creating geometric patterns with characteristic soft edges that only this process can produce. Together, they make a saree that carries centuries of Indian craft heritage in every thread.
